Permalink Reply by David Von Niemandsland on October 23, 2011 at 22:17 Regarding Devil Mayfair, if anyone is still looking for this track, I have a very high quality 25 minute Rehearsal tape from January 11th 1992 which includes the track. The tracklist is: Unbridled at Dusk, The Black Goddess Rises, The Raping of Earth, and Devil Mayfair. The Raping of Earth is The Raping of Faith, but 'Earth' is what is written on the demo.
This tape is a second generation copy- a record store in Grünstadt (I believe it was called Echoes) copied a first generation tape for me around 1994 or 1995. I contacted them regarding a few other albums and they sent a catalogue with my order which included this and a few other oddities. If anyone would like an MP3 copy, I am happy to share. There is no artwork per say other than a Xerox of the typewritten tracklist and recording date.
All four tracks lead into each other clearly, so this is definitely part of the original demo. I have never heard this track on any of their other recordings, but if anyone recognizes this as a different COF track, please correct me.
